Are you unable to get to your healthcare appointments due to not being able to drive or use public transport?

Do you live in Highcliffe, Walkford, Friars Cliff or Mudeford?
(BH23 “4 “and BH23 “5” Postcodes)

If so, Highcliffe Friends in Need may be able to find a volunteer driver
to drive you to your appointment and back home again.

  • You will need to book a week in advance where possible – a minimum of at least 2 weekdays notice.
  • Transport is provided in the volunteer driver’s own car; the driver is only responsible for you whilst you are in their car and covered by their car insurance.
  • Clients requiring assistance, especially when attending appointments, will need to be accompanied by a friend or carer.
  • We are unable to take clients in wheelchairs, but mobility aids can usually be accommodated, please make the coordinator aware of which type you have when you book.
  • Users of the scheme will be invited to make a suggested voluntary donation to cover the driver's costs.
  • We cannot always guarantee being able to meet your needs, but we will do our best to assist you.

Founded in 1973, Highcliffe Friends in Need is a Volunteer Car Driver Scheme providing for transport to healthcare appointments for those no longer able to drive or use public transport.

Since 2013, Highcliffe Friends in Need has donated a total of £22.400, divided between 18 local charities.
